WebCyndy Hendershot in 2001 wrote that the film examines "issues of conformity and individuality" through a "metaphor of monstrous transformation". Hendershot says that while Blake the professor represents conformity, Blake the caveman is a representation of individuality. WebCynthia Hendershot started her career as a teaching assistant at Texas Tech University in 1990. She held this post until 1995. She also worked as an instructor at Clovis Community College in 1992. She held the same post at Cannon Air Force Base from 1992 to 1996. In 1996 she became a lecturer at Texas Tech University.
